			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I would describe my approach to life as &#8220;there is always a silver lining, even if you have to look really hard to find it.&#8221; Seeing life this way is more than simply thinking positively or putting on a happy face, which I don&#8217;t think are helpful at all.</p>
<p>But not everyone is comfortable with this approach, so I don&#8217;t try to convince anyone else to adopt it. Heck, there are only a few people who I am comfortable talking about my own life this way!</p>
<p>For example, we had our roof replaced Fall of 2017. It started leaking the next Spring (the roofing company refused to fix it, so we are taking them to court, but that&#8217;s a story for another time). Most people would see that leak as something to get depressed and sad about, but not me. I see it as a gift. A really annoying gift, but a gift nonetheless. Because without it, we would not have known how horrible a job these roofers did until 5 or 10 or 20(!) years from now after significant damage was done to our home (think requiring the removal of the entire roof, including the rafters) and the roofing company was no longer in business.</p>
